How much do coordinator case health j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for coordinator case health in the United States is $22.72,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.51 and $25.00 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a coordinator case health?

Coordinator Case Health professionals, often known as health case coordinators, oversee and manage patient care plans within healthcare settings. They work closely with patients, families, and healthcare providers to ensure that individuals receive appropriate and timely medical services. Their responsibilities include assessing patient needs, coordinating services, monitoring progress, and providing support throughout the care process. By acting as a liaison between different parties, they help improve patient outcomes and ensure efficient use of healthcare resources.

What are some common challenges faced by a coordinator case health, and how can they be effectively managed?

A Coordinator Case Health often encounters challenges such as balancing multiple patient cases, navigating complex healthcare systems, and ensuring clear communication among interdisciplinary teams. Effectively managing these challenges requires strong organizational skills, the ability to prioritize urgent cases, and proactive communication with both patients and healthcare providers. Utilizing electronic health records and established protocols can streamline workflow, while regular team meetings help maintain alignment and address any issues promptly.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a coordinator case health?

To thrive as a Coordinator Case Health, you generally need a background in healthcare or social work, knowledge of case management principles, and often a related degree or certification such as CCM (Certified Case Manager). Familiarity with electronic medical records (EMRs), care coordination platforms, and insurance authorization systems is typically required. Strong organizational skills, empathy, and effective communication are vital soft skills for managing complex cases and collaborating with multidisciplinary teams. These competencies ensure efficient patient care coordination, improved outcomes, and positive experiences for both patients and providers.

What is the difference between Coordinator Case Health vs Case Manager?

AspectCoordinator Case HealthCase Manager
CredentialsOften requires a healthcare-related certification or associate degreeTypically requires a nursing license or healthcare certification
Work EnvironmentHealthcare facilities, insurance companies, community health programsHospitals, clinics, insurance companies, social service agencies
Primary ResponsibilitiesCoordinating patient care, scheduling, communication between providersAssessing patient needs, developing care plans, advocating for patients

Coordinator Case Health roles focus on organizing and facilitating patient services and communication, often requiring coordination skills and healthcare certifications. Case Managers have a broader scope in patient assessment, care planning, and advocacy, often requiring nursing or specialized healthcare credentials. Both roles are vital in healthcare settings but differ mainly in scope and responsibilities.

About Vista Life Innovations
For more than 35 years, Vista Life Innovations has supported adults with disabilities in building independent lives, finding meaningful work, and becoming active members of their communities. Our programs are grounded in a person-centered philosophy, meeting each individual where they are and supporting them toward greater independence at every stage of life.
The Role
Vista is seeking a Case Coordinator (Case Manager) to provide a combination of direct support and case coordination services for identified Engage members. The Case Coordinator maintains an assigned caseload and serves as the primary point of contact for members, families, guardians, support teams, and community partners.
Approximately 30 hours per week are dedicated to direct service delivery and participant coordination. Remaining scheduled hours are dedicated to administrative duties, supervision, documentation, meetings, family communication, and indirect service coordination.
What Youโ€™ll Do
  • Support students and members in developing independence across life skills, social, cognitive, vocational, and community-based areas through individualized instruction and skill-building strategies.
  • Develop, implement, and monitor written program plans, including IPPs and IPs, that identify goals, service needs, progress, and individualized supports.
  • Coordinate and monitor assigned caseload needs by communicating with team members, families, departments, and other involved parties to ensure consistent support and service delivery.
  • Provide direct instruction, coaching, and counseling related to social skills, cognitive development, medication awareness, money management, time management, work readiness, goal setting, and performance review.
  • Provide direct supervision to Life Skills Instructor(s).
  • Create and implement procedures to assist other Life Skills Instructors to use assistive technology to assist students with gaining independence.
  • Evaluate a student/memberโ€™s progress and provide appropriate training interventions.
What Weโ€™re Looking For
  • Bachelorโ€™s degree plus one year of related experience.
  • Valid driverโ€™s license and maintain acceptable driving record as defined by Vista.
  • CPR, First Aid and PMT certified or the ability to obtain certifications within 90 days of hire.
  • Transport students and members in either personal or Vista car/van to community sites in a variety of settings and weather conditions.
  • Knowledge and skills in MS Office, including Outlook and the internet.
